P1740 Possible Causes
- Low transmission fluid level
- Dirty transmission fluid
- Faulty Torque Converter Clutch (TCC) and Overdrive (OD) Solenoid
- Torque Converter Clutch (TCC) and Overdrive (OD) Solenoid harness is open or shorted
- Torque Converter Clutch (TCC) and Overdrive (OD) Solenoid circuit poor electrical connection
How do I fix code P1740?
Check the “Possible Causes” listed above. Visually inspect the related w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and look for bro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ded connector’s pins.

P1740 Description
Torque Converter Clutch (TCC) and Overdrive (OD) clutch are tested when the Powertrain Control Module (PCM) requests TCC engagement in 3rd gear and Overdrive. The P1740 code will set if expected RPM drop is not achieved while attempting to engine TCC and/or Overdrive. The P1740 code indicates malfunctioning torque converter or overdrive clutch.
